## Alert: StatRelay Sidecar Flush Lag

This alert fires when the StatRelay metrics-aggregation sidecar falls more than 120 seconds behind on flushing buffered samples to the Coalmine backend. Plugin-emitted counters are buffered in-process, so sustained lag usually means a plugin is emitting unbounded label cardinality or blocking the flush thread. Check your plugin's metric registration against the published cardinality limits before escalating. If the lag persists after your plugin is ruled out, contact the telemetry team.

escalation mailbox, bagug-fahof: novdor.wendor.jormir@norvalabs.example

- [ ] ProctorPipe queue drain check: before you flip the flag, make sure the exam-proctoring queue at Varnhollow is empty or under 50 items. If it's backed up, give it ten minutes — don't force it, candidates mid-exam will get booted. Ping the Drowsy Owl rotation if it won't drain. The build we're shipping is noted below.

session token of tajef-bageg = htk21_5d90d574934f3ccae6437

# LiftSim env — elevator-dispatch simulator for the Corven Tower model.
# New folks: SIM_TICK_MS controls step resolution; don't go below 50.
# CAR_COUNT and FLOOR_COUNT must match the scenario file or the run
# aborts. Logs land in /var/liftsim. Results upload to the metrics
# relay, which requires a credential set on the following line.

vault entry, yahif-yajep: COURIER_KEY29=b802bdf8034096b65a51c6ba5abe2